Techcare is a managed IT and cyber security business serving accountancy practices, law firms and other regulated firms across the West Midlands.
We’ve grown steadily since 2008, heading for £3M turnover and this year won Greater Birmingham Chamber of Commerce awards for Customer Commitment and Business of the Year.
Finance has been led by our Founder and CEO since day one.
You’ll be our first finance hire, taking on the day-to-day, working closely with the CEO.
A fractional Finance Director is available monthly for the higher-level technical calls.
How you work with the wider team matters as much as the numbers.
We want someone who respects how the business has developed and builds trust, taking people with them when changes are proposed and who relishes the challenge of creating structure early on.
The full day to day finance cycle: board management accounts by working day 10 with commentary that explains the movement, cashflow forecasting, sales and purchase ledger, credit control, VAT and payroll input.
The part that makes the difference is billing accuracy.
We bill hundreds of monthly service agreements and the detail shifts constantly, so you’ll keep what we charge clients and what our suppliers charge us reconciled, catching the gaps before they cost.
Then the commercial work: profitability by project and by client, margin by service line and the pricing calls, telling us what a price change does to the P&L.
That analysis is why we're hiring.
